Linux系统空间清理小窍门

小标题1:清理不使用的软件

在Linux系统中,长期使用可能会积累不少不使用的软件,这些软件占据着宝贵的硬盘空间。因此,我们需要定期清理这些不使用的软件。

使用以下命令列出系统中的所有软件:

apt list --installed

找出不使用的软件,使用以下命令进行卸载:

apt remove 软件名

一定要谨慎操作,确保所卸载的软件不再需要。

小标题2:清理缓存文件

在使用Linux系统的过程中,许多程序会生成临时文件或缓存文件,以提高程序的运行速度。然而,这些文件会占用磁盘空间,因此需要定期清理。

子标题1:清理apt缓存

使用apt-get工具下载软件包时,会将软件包缓存在本地。可以使用以下命令清理apt缓存:

sudo apt-get clean

这将删除/var/cache/apt/archives目录下的所有软件包。

子标题2:清理浏览器缓存

浏览器会将下载的文件和网页缓存在本地,以提高浏览速度。然而,这些缓存文件会逐渐占据大量磁盘空间。因此,需要定期清理浏览器缓存。

具体清理方法因浏览器而异,下面以谷歌浏览器为例:

打开谷歌浏览器,点击右上角的自定义和控制谷歌浏览器按钮(三个竖直点)。

选择 "更多工具"。

选择 "清除浏览数据"。

选择 "高级" 选项卡,并选择要清除的数据类型(如缓存文件、Cookie等)。

点击 "清除数据"。

等待清理完成。

注意:清理浏览器缓存将删除所有已下载的文件和保存的登录状态,请谨慎使用该功能。

小标题3:删除日志文件

日志文件是记录系统运行信息的重要组成部分,但长期积累的日志文件会占据大量磁盘空间。因此,我们需要定期清理不再需要的日志文件。

使用以下命令删除旧的系统日志文件:

sudo rm /var/log/*.log.*

请谨慎操作,确保所删除的日志文件不再需要。

小标题4:压缩和归档文件

如果您有大量的文件和文件夹,但不经常使用它们,可以考虑将它们压缩和归档,以节省磁盘空间。

使用以下命令将文件或文件夹压缩成tar.gz格式:

tar -zcvf 压缩文件名.tar.gz 要压缩的文件或文件夹

例如,要压缩名为 "documents" 的文件夹,可以使用以下命令:

tar -zcvf documents.tar.gz documents/

注意:压缩和归档文件后,您将无法直接访问其中的文件和文件夹,需要解压缩才能使用。

小标题5:删除不需要的内核

在运行Linux系统时,可能会存在多个版本的内核,但实际上只使用其中一个。因此,我们可以删除不需要的内核版本,以释放宝贵的磁盘空间。

使用以下命令查看当前安装的内核:

dpkg --list | grep linux-image

找出不需要的内核,并使用以下命令进行卸载:

sudo apt-get purge 内核包名

例如,要卸载内核版本为 "4.15.0-47",可以使用以下命令:

sudo apt-get purge linux-image-4.15.0-47

注意:删除内核可能导致系统不稳定,请谨慎操作,并确保只删除不需要的内核。

小标题6:查找大文件和文件夹

有时候,我们可能无法确定哪些文件和文件夹占用了大量的磁盘空间。在这种情况下,我们可以使用以下命令查找大文件和文件夹:

du -ah . | sort -rh | head -n 10

这将列出当前文件夹中最大的10个文件和文件夹。

注意:该命令可能需要一些时间来完成,取决于文件系统的大小。

小标题7:清理垃圾邮件

如果您使用邮件客户端收发邮件,可能会积累大量的垃圾邮件。这些垃圾邮件会占据大量的存储空间,并且会增加系统备份和维护的负担。

可以使用以下命令删除垃圾邮件:

rm -rf ~/.local/share/Trash/*

这将清空垃圾邮件文件夹中的所有文件。

注意:请确保为要删除的文件夹提供正确的路径,以避免误删其他文件。

小标题8:使用磁盘清理工具

除了手动清理外,您还可以使用一些磁盘清理工具来帮助您自动清理系统空间。

例如,BleachBit是一个开源的磁盘清理工具,可以清理临时文件、缓存文件、浏览器历史记录等。

要安装BleachBit,请使用以下命令:

sudo apt-get install bleachbit

安装完成后,您可以从应用菜单中打开BleachBit,并按照提示进行清理操作。

小标题9:定期维护和清理

为了保持Linux系统的最佳状态,除了以上方法,定期的维护和清理也是必不可少的。

您可以创建一个定期的任务,例如每周清理一次磁盘空间,或者每月清理一次不需要的软件和文件。

这样做不仅可以释放磁盘空间,还可以提高系统的整体性能。

综上所述,通过清理不使用的软件、清理缓存文件、删除日志文件、压缩和归档文件、删除不需要的内核、查找大文件和文件夹、清理垃圾邮件以及使用磁盘清理工具,我们可以有效地清理Linux系统的空间,提高系统的性能和稳定性。

操作系统标签